What You'll Do:
* Lead and coordinate Health, Safety, and Environmental activities across the site.
* Maintain a strong presence on the factory floor, engaging with operators and shift teams.
* Deliver and maintain risk assessments, safe systems of work, and machinery safety checks.
* Conduct accident and incident investigations and support root cause analysis.
* Ensure compliance with COSHH, PUWER, RIDDOR, and industry-specific safety requirements.
* Support site certifications, including ISO 14001.
* Deliver safety briefings, toolbox talks, and HSE training.
* Collaborate with Food Safety, Technical, Engineering, and Operations teams.
* Identify trends, analyze data, and drive continuous improvement actions.
* Promote a proactive, open, and positive safety culture.
What You'll Bring:
* NEBOSH Diploma or equivalent.
* IOSH membership.
* An environmental qualification such as AIEMA.
* H&S auditing/training qualification.
* Previous Health & Safety experience within a food manufacturing, FMCG food, or related environment.
* Strong track record of frontline engagement on the production floor.
* Practical experience with accident investigation, risk assessments, and day-to-day HSE delivery.
* Understanding of food manufacturing operations, including hygiene zones, allergens, and fast-moving machinery.
* Hands-on, people-focused leadership style.
* Able to influence and communicate effectively at all levels.
* Confident working in a fast-paced FMCG environment.
* Strong organizational and problem-solving skills.
